Microsoft 365 Security Administration – Complete Overview

The Microsoft 365 Security Administration certification validates a professional’s ability to implement, manage, and monitor security solutions across Microsoft 365 services. It focuses on protecting identities, data, devices, and applications while ensuring compliance and reducing organizational risk in cloud-based environments.

This certification is intended for IT professionals responsible for securing Microsoft 365 workloads. It demonstrates the ability to configure security policies, manage threat protection, and respond to security incidents using Microsoft security tools and technologies.

What Is the Microsoft 365 Security Administration Certification?

The Microsoft 365 Security Administration certification measures skills in implementing and managing security controls across Microsoft 365. It covers identity protection, threat protection, information protection, and security management using services such as Microsoft Defender, Microsoft Purview, and Microsoft Entra ID.

This certification confirms expertise in safeguarding organizational assets while supporting secure collaboration and productivity within Microsoft 365.

Exam Objectives

  1. Implement and manage identity and access security
  2. Implement and manage threat protection solutions
  3. Implement information protection and data loss prevention
  4. Manage security alerts and incident response
  5. Configure and manage security policies for Microsoft 365 workloads

Exam Format

The exam consists of multiple-choice questions, scenario-based items, and case studies that assess the candidate’s ability to configure and manage Microsoft 365 security solutions. It emphasizes real-world scenarios involving identity protection, threat detection, data loss prevention, and compliance enforcement.

Exam details

Exam Code: MS-500

No. of Questions: 60

Launch Date: N/A

Exam Length: 120 Minutes

Passing Score: 700

Language: English and selected regional languages

Retirement Date: N/A

Certificate Type: Pearson VUE
